This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in United Kingdom, +1 more country.
• Oversee a team of approximately 12 engineers distributed across three product teams through regular one-on-one meetings, coaching, and providing clear feedback.
• Establish clear expectations and define effective performance standards.
• Proactively identify performance challenges and manage difficult conversations as needed.
• Assist engineers in their development from junior roles to senior positions and beyond.
• Take ownership of the engineering performance and progression strategy.
• Evaluate and enhance career levels, expectations, and review procedures.
• Make consistent, evidence-driven decisions regarding promotions and career progression.
• Promote a culture of continuous feedback throughout the year.
• Collaborate with Tech Leads and the broader team on engineering hiring initiatives.
• Define hiring requirements, evaluate candidates, and uphold a high hiring standard.
• Ensure a structured and beneficial onboarding experience for new engineers.
• Strategically plan team composition, capability development, and future hiring needs.
• Monitor engagement, retention, collaboration, and emerging personnel issues.
• Partner with Tech Leads on matters related to technical delivery, behavior, and team dynamics.
• Cultivate a robust remote engineering culture.
• Stay engaged enough with engineering tasks to comprehend the team's challenges and environment.
• Review code, track pull requests, and engage thoughtfully in technical discussions.
• Collaborate with Tech Leads without competing for ownership of technical decisions.
• Work closely with the Head of Engineering, with support from the People team and meaningful autonomy.
